Cost of Living: Freeland, MI vs Woodstock, GA

Housing

The housing market plays a significant role in determining the cost of living.

Metric Freeland Woodstock
Housing Index 90.0 110.0
Median Home Price $199,900 $350,000
Average Rent (2 BR Apartment) $1400 $1800
Average Rent (2 BR House) $1232 $2000

Housing Comparison: Freeland vs Woodstock

  • The median home price in Woodstock is higher at $350,000, compared to $199,900 in Freeland.
  • In Woodstock, the rental for a two-bedroom apartment stands at $1,800, while it is $1,400 in Freeland.
